I tried the ventilated seats on mine yesterday and it worked very well. Felt a cooling sensation even on my lower back.

Mine was built in November 24 (52xxxVIN)
Yeah, they are a lifesaver in really sticky weather. The secret to making them work better is put the Climate Control on Manual and make sure you have some good A/C airflow coming out of the foot vents. That supplies cool, dry air for the fans in the seats to suck up off the cabin floor.
